On September 1, 2007, the Telecom Regulatory Authority of India reigned in the 'don't call regime' with setting up of the NDNC. Subscribers had to register with the NDNC by calling the respective service provider and the marketing calls were to stop within the next 45 days. However, even after 10 months, unsolicited calls still haunt mobile users.
On a cloudy Monday this month, Mohammed Irshad flew from Kochi to Gurugram to attend an exclusive investor networking event. Among a handful of founders selected for the event, Irshad was to pitch his peer-to-peer learning start-up Notespaedia for funding in front of top venture capital investors such as AngelBay, Elevation Capital, and Inflection Point Ventures. He failed to woo them, but the feisty entrepreneur was determined to continue his hunt.
